【中文】一种基于位置信息的定位精度计算方法和装置 【EN】Positioning accuracy calculation method and device based on position information
申请号:
201811429842.3
公开号:CN111221005A 主分类号:G01S19/23
申请人:
【中文】千寻位置网络有限公司【EN】QIANXUN SPATIAL INTELLIGENCE Inc.
申请日:2018.11.27 公开日:2020.06.02
发明人:
【中文】王芳【EN】
Wang Fang
摘要:【中文】本发明提供了一种基于位置信息的定位精度计算方法和装置,所述方法包括以下步骤:收集一个历元内的所有GSV语句,对所有GSV语句进行分析,排除卫星仰角小于预设数值的卫星,得到剩余有效卫星数量;预设参与精度计算的有效卫星的比例系数,对有效卫星进行排序,根据比例系数计算有效卫星的讯号噪声比的平均值;预设精度计算模型,根据精度计算模型计算定位精度,预设精度计算模型包括X轴、Y轴、Z轴三个维度,所述X轴为讯号噪声比的平均值,Y轴为有效卫星数量,Z轴为位置点精度。本发明方便行业用户根据自己日常路测和实践数据得出适合于其设备的精准度计算规则。 【EN】The invention provides a method and a device for calculating positioning accuracy based on position information, wherein the method comprises the following steps: collecting all GSV statements in an epoch, analyzing all GSV statements, and removing satellites with satellite elevation angles smaller than a preset value to obtain the number of the remaining effective satellites; presetting the proportional coefficients of the effective satellites participating in the precision calculation, sequencing the effective satellites, and calculating the average value of the signal-to-noise ratios of the effective satellites according to the proportional coefficients; and presetting a precision calculation model, and calculating the positioning precision according to the precision calculation model, wherein the preset precision calculation model comprises three dimensions of an X axis, a Y axis and a Z axis, the X axis is the average value of the signal-to-noise ratio, the Y axis is the number of effective satellites, and the Z axis is the precision of the position point. The invention is convenient for the industry user to obtain the accuracy calculation rule suitable for the equipment according to the daily drive test and practice data.
